Discover the Historic HBP Theater at St. Cecilia Hall
The HBP Theater at St. Cecilia Hall is more than a theater — it's a historic showcase that blends timeless architecture with modern performance technology. Located on the Cotter Schools campus in Winona, this venue brings the community together for concerts and special events. If you’re browsing HBP Theater at St. Cecilia Hall upcoming events, expect an inviting setting where music and community take center stage.
A major renovation in 2017 upgraded the theater’s capabilities while preserving its historic character — the best of old and new under one roof. Modern sound and lighting systems support a wide range of performances, with professional technicians on staff to meet event requirements. It’s a comfortable, polished environment designed to enhance every note and every moment.
From celebrated runs of the Highway 61 Concert Series to school and community showcases, programming here balances marquee experiences with local engagement. The Highway 61 Concert Series has become a calling card, welcoming artists and audiences for memorable nights of live music in a refined, theater setting. Location and Transportation
Venue Address
HBP Theater at St. Cecilia Hall
1115 W. Broadway
Winona, MN 55987
HBP Theater at St. Cecilia Hall sits on the Cotter Schools campus in Winona — approximately 120 miles southeast of Minneapolis. It’s convenient for regional visitors and an easy night out for locals.
- Parking: On-campus parking lots serve event attendees; arrive early to find the closest spaces.
- Public Transit: Limited public transit options available
- Rideshare & Dropoff: Designated pickup zones available near main entrance

Other Things to Do in Winona
Beyond the music, the Winona area offers incredible attractions for visitors heading to HBP Theater at St. Cecilia Hall:
- Minnesota Marine Art Museum — Renowned for its impressive collection of marine-themed artwork and American masterpieces.
- Garvin Heights Overlook — Scenic bluff offering panoramic views of Winona and the Mississippi River Valley.
- Great River Bluffs State Park — Outdoor recreation area with hiking trails and stunning river vistas.
- Lake Winona — Popular for walking, biking, fishing, and paddle sports in the heart of the city.
- Winona National Bank Building — Historic landmark known for its Prairie School architecture.
- Polish Cultural Institute and Museum — Museum celebrating Winona’s Polish heritage and immigrant history.
- Watkins Heritage Museum — Museum dedicated to the history of the J.R. Watkins Company and its impact on Winona.
- Sugar Loaf Bluff — Iconic limestone bluff and hiking destination with city views.
- Winona County Historical Society — Museum and research center exploring local history.
